BOARD OF SUPERVISORS
RESOLUTION TO PROVIDE RESIDENTIAL CURBSIDE REFUSE PICKUP
WHEREAS, Frederick County has identified the need to provide a more cost-effective
alternative to meet solid waste disposal needs in a time when the solid waste industry is challenged
by increased operational burdens; and
WHEREAS, the findings of the Government 12 Service Learning Project confirmed the
recommendations of the Public Works Committee and staff identifying the need for more
comprehensive disposal alternatives in Frederick County;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to Title 15.2 ~ 930 Paragraph B, Frederick County held a public
hearing for the purpose of soliciting the public's input regarding the feasibility of providing curbside
refuse pickup in the more densely populated areas of Frederick County; and
NOW, TH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, that the Frederick County Board of Supervisors
does hereby resolve to allow for the implementation of curbside refuse pickup in the more densely
populated areas of Frederick County following a five-year waiting period as prescribed by the Code
of Virginia.
ADOPTED this 12th day of August, 1998.
